This app, "Grade 8 Oromia - All Textbooks," aims to provide Grade 8 students in the Oromia region of Ethiopia with a complete digital library of their textbooks and teacher's guides. It essentially replaces the need to carry physical textbooks, offering a more accessible and flexible learning experience. The core function is to provide offline access to all required reading materials for the Oromia Grade 8 curriculum.
The key features highlighted are designed to enhance the learning process. The "Popup Notes in Book View" allows students to take notes directly within the app without interrupting their reading flow, a significant advantage over physical textbooks. The "Crop & Snap" feature allows users to capture and save specific sections of the textbook, which can be extremely useful for focused study and creating personalized study guides. The inclusion of "Bookmarks" provides easy navigation and quick access to frequently referenced pages. The "Day & Night Reading Modes" cater to different lighting conditions, promoting comfortable reading at any time. Finally, the offline access is a major strength, enabling students to study even without an internet connection, which is crucial in areas with limited connectivity.

Overall, "Grade 8 Oromia - All Textbooks" presents a promising solution for delivering educational content to students in the Oromia region. The features are well-considered and address common challenges associated with traditional textbook learning. The offline access and integrated note-taking capabilities are particularly valuable. However, the 0/5 rating on the Google Play Store raises serious concerns. This could indicate significant technical issues, inaccurate content, or a lack of user satisfaction. Before recommending this app, it's crucial to investigate the reasons behind the low rating and ensure the app functions as described and provides accurate, reliable information. If the issues are resolved, this app has the potential to be a valuable educational resource.
